A bird's-eye view of frozen Massachusetts beach
2021-03-11 2 Dailymotion
Ryan Canty, a Massachusetts resident, captured the amazing power of nature while visiting his grandmother's house by the sea: Old Silver Beach in North Falmouth, totally frozen.